Observers at the National Assembly: At a meeting held on Saturday, July 24, 2021, at the National Assembly, Alfonso Ortiz Cobo, Executive Director of the Mochica Sumpa Human, Eco-Environmental, and Cultural Rights Corporation, was present as a transparency observer thanks to an invitation issued by the Oversight and Audit Committee.
